Whole Cell PCR

Adapted from D. Kirkpatrick (4/15/98)

  • Put 6µ l of dH2O into a 0.2 ml eppendorf tube.
  • Transfer cells from colony on plate to the tube using a toothpick.
  • Small amount of cells is best — water should be translucent.
  • Use a brand new toothpick, discard after use.
  • Heat tube at 94oC for 6 min. in PCR machine.
  • Place tube in -80oC freezer for 5 min. (minimum), can go overnight.
  • Add 19µ l PCR mix:
    • dH2O 3.25µ l
    • 10X buffer 2.5
    • 25mM MgCl 1.5
    • 1µ M Primer 1 5
    • 1µ M Primer 2 5
    • 10mM dNTP 0.5
    • Taq 0.25
    • TOTAL 19µ l
  • Mix by pipetting.
  • Put in PCR machine, run program <Eric> folder, Genomic
    • 94oC 3min.
    • 94oC 30sec.
    • 55oC 30sec. 40 cycles
    • 72oC 3min.
